Celanese Far East, a unit of specialty materials company Celanese, signed a memorandum of understanding (MoU) PetroChina Company for the development of synthetic fuel ethanol.

Under this MoU, the two companies will jointly develop synthetic fuel ethanol opportunities in China using Celanese’s proprietary TCX ethanol process technology.

Celanese’s technology is a modern ethanol production process involves conversion of domestic natural gas and coal feedstocks to liquid fuel.
